Add 4/15 and 84/10
1st number: 4/15, 2nd number: 8 4/10
4/15 + 84/10 is 26/3.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 15 and 10 is 30
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 30 - For the 1st fraction, since 15 × 2 = 30,
4/15 = 4 × 2/15 × 2 = 8/30 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 10 × 3 = 30,
84/10 = 84 × 3/10 × 3 = 252/30 - Add the two like fractions:
8/30 + 252/30 = 8 + 252/30 = 260/30 - 260/30 simplified gives 26/3
- So, 4/15 + 84/10 = 26/3
